General Meionite Information

Help on Chemical  Formula: Chemical Formula: Ca4Al6Si6O24CO3
Help on Composition: Composition: Molecular Weight = 934.71 gm
   Calcium   17.15 %  Ca   24.00 % CaO
   Aluminum  17.32 %  Al   32.73 % Al2O3
   Silicon   18.03 %  Si   38.57 % SiO2
   Carbon     1.28 %  C     4.71 % CO2
   Oxygen    46.22 %  O
            ______        ______ 
            100.00 %      100.00 % = TOTAL OXIDE
Help on Empirical Formula: Empirical Formula: Ca4Al6Si6O24(CO3)
Help on Environment: Environment: Small cavities in limestone ejecta blocks. Forms a series with marialite.
Help on IMA Status: IMA Status: Valid Species (Pre-IMA) 1801
Help on Locality: Locality: Mte. Somma, Vesuvius, Italy. Link to MinDat.org Location Data.
Help on Name Origin: Name Origin: From the Greek for "less", referring to its less acute pyramidal form compared with vesuvianite.

Meionite Crystallography

Help on Axial Ratios: Axial Ratios: a:c = 1:0.62071
Help on Cell Dimensions: Cell Dimensions: a = 12.26, c = 7.61, Z = 2; V = 1,143.84 Den(Calc)= 2.71
Help on Crystal System: Crystal System: Tetragonal - DipyramidalH-M Symbol (4/m) Space Group: P 4/m
Help on X Ray Diffraction: X Ray Diffraction: By Intensity(I/Io): 3.464(1), 3.069(0.7), 3.824(0.6),

Physical Properties of Meionite

Help on Cleavage: Cleavage: {???} Distinct, {???} Indistinct
Help on Color: Color: Bluish, Brownish, Colorless, Violet, Greenish.
Help on Density: Density: 2.66 - 2.73, Average = 2.69
Help on Diaphaneity: Diaphaneity: Transparent to subtranslucent
Help on Fracture: Fracture: Sub Conchoidal - Fractures developed in brittle materials characterized by semi-curving surfaces.
Help on Habit: Habit: Columnar - Forms columns
Help on Habit: Habit: Fibrous - Crystals made up of fibers.
Help on Habit: Habit: Massive - Granular - Common texture observed in granite and other igneous rock.
Help on Hardness: Hardness: 5-6 - Between Apatite and Orthoclase
Help on Luminescence: Luminescence: Fluorescent, Short UV=yellow-white, Long UV=red.
Help on Luster: Luster: Vitreous - Resinous
Help on Streak: Streak: colorless
 

Optical Properties of Meionite

Help on Gladstone-Dale: Gladstone-Dale: CI meas= -0.02 (Excellent) - where the CI = (1-KPDmeas/KC)
CI calc= -0.014 (Superior) - where the CI = (1-KPDcalc/KC)
KPDcalc= 0.2113,KPDmeas= 0.2124,KC= 0.2083
Ncalc = 1.55 - 1.57
Help on Optical Data: Optical Data: Uniaxial (-), e=1.55-1.56, w=1.58-1.6, bire=0.0300-0.0400.

Meionite Classification

Help on  Dana Class: Dana Class: 76.03.01.02 (76)Tectosilicate Al-Si Framework
  (76.03)with other Be/Al/Si frameworks
  (76.03.01)Scapolite group
 
76.03.01.00 Scapolite* (Na,Ca)4[Al3Si9O24]Cl P 41/n 4/m
 
76.03.01.01 Marialite Na4Al3Si9O24Cl I 4/m 4/m
 
76.03.01.02 Meionite Ca4Al6Si6O24CO3 P 4/m 4/m
 
76.03.01.03 Silvialite! (Ca,Na)4Al6Si6O24(SO4,CO3) I 4/m 4/m
Help on  Strunz Class: Strunz Class: 09.FB.15 09 - SILICATES (Germanates)
  09.F - Tektosilicates without Zeolitic H2O
  09.FB -Tektosilicates with additional anions
 
09.FB.15 Meionite Ca4Al6Si6O24CO3 P 4/m 4/m
 
09.FB.15 Marialite Na4Al3Si9O24Cl I 4/m 4/m
 
09.FB.15 Scapolite* (Na,Ca)4[(Al,Si)12O24]Cl P 41/n 4/m
 
09.FB.15 Silvialite! (Ca,Na)4Al6Si6O24(SO4,CO3) I 4/m 4/m
